Babuka by Slava Meskhi is a free rounded display font built from broad curves and gently changing stroke widths. Its open, looping forms have an easy handwritten motion, with compact joins and occasional hooked endings. The silhouette stays loose and lively.
It is strongest in children's publishing, where the buoyant shapes can turn a cover title into part of the illustration. The same friendly construction suits toy packaging and animated entertainment, especially alongside simple character art and rounded graphic forms. Festival posters and casual cafe branding offer another good setting for its warm, rolling lines and distinctly informal lettering style.
